About Maria Simi

Maria Simi is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Information Systems,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Molecular Biology and Sociology and Political Science, having authored 45 papers that have together received 450 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Natural Language Processing Techniques (28 papers), Topic Modeling (20 papers), Semantic Web and Ontologies (10 papers), Speech and dialogue systems (6 papers), Logic, Reasoning, and Knowledge (5 papers), Text Readability and Simplification (5 papers), Logic, programming, and type systems (3 papers) and Data Management and Algorithms (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Artificial Intelligence (396 citations), Information Systems (84 citations), Software (11 citations), Language and Linguistics (20 citations) and Computer Networks and Communications (42 citations). Maria Simi has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and Sweden. Frequent co-authors include Giuseppe Attardi, Simonetta Montemagni⋄, Cristina Bosco, Felice Dell’Orletta⋄, Antonio Cisternino, Fabrizio Sebastiani, Joseph Turian, Massimiliano Ciaramita, Francesco Formica and Atanas Chanev. Their work appears in journals such as Language Resources and Evaluation, Journal of Logic Language and Information, BIT Numerical Mathematics, Interaction design & architecture(s) and Artificial intelligence for engineering design analysis and manufacturing.
